Legon Cities sack head coach after GPL slump

Legon Cities FC have sacked head coach Goran Barjaktarevic after 11 months in charge.

The Bosnian-German was hired in December 2019 after their then coach John Paintsil, “was relieved of his role following his failure to meet the Club Licensing Regulations which clearly stipulates the qualification required by head coaches in the Premier League”.

In the truncated 2019/2020 season, the Royals occupied the 15th position with three wins out of 15 games.

In the transfer window, he was given the needed boost to spark confidence for the season as 12 players were signed including Ghana’s all-time topscorer, Asamoah Gyan and wonder kid, Matthew Anim Cudjoe.

However, Goran Barjaktarevic did not utilize them to their full potential.

Their 3-0 loss to Accra Great Olympics was the last straw that broke the camel’s back for his employers and he has been shown the exit.

Currently, they sit 15th on the GPL table and it’s not clear who will be in charge of the team.

Their next game is against Premier League favourites, Medeama SC.
